单词 chickadee
释义

chickadeen.

Brit. /ˈtʃɪkədiː/, /ˌtʃɪkəˈdiː/, U.S. /ˈtʃɪkəˌdi/, /ˌtʃɪkəˈdi/
Forms: 1800s– chicadee, 1800s– chickadee.
Origin: An imitative or expressive formation.
Etymology: Imitative of the bird's call. Compare kiskadee n.With the specific use as a term of endearment compare chick n.1 I.
Originally North American.
1. Any of several North American titmice of the genus Poecilus; esp. (more fully black-capped chickadee) P. atricapillus of forests in Canada and the northern United States. The black-capped chickadee is closely allied to the Eurasian willow tit ( P. montanus), and was formerly thought to be conspecific with it.

1832 Encycl. Amer. XII. 281/1 The black-capt titmouse, or chick-a-dee, is the most familiar.
1884 E. P. Roe in Harper's Mag. Mar. 615/1 We all know the lively black-capped chickadees.
1907 ‘N. Blanchan’ Birds Every Child should Know ii. 19 No bird, except the wren, is more cheerful than the chickadee, and his cheerfulness, fortunately, is just as ‘catching’ as measles.
2008 E. Royte Bottlemania iii. 64 The air is alive with the peeping of chickadees and the skronk of blue jays.
2. A child; also as a term of endearment or affectionate form of address for a child or a woman.

1860 J. G. Holland Miss Gilbert's Career iv. 62 When a feller gets tied to a wife, and has a lot of little chickadees around him.
1968 Listener 23 May 678/1 Mr Durrell, looking so much like a sober W. C. Fields that one expected him to address Joan Bakewell as ‘my little chickadee’.
2010 T. French Faithful Place xix. 19 No nightmares tonight, OK, chickadee?
